Steps to Follow:

Identify the Problem: The initial step in bifold door hinge repair is to recognize the issue. Examine if the door is drooping, tough to open or close, or if there are any visible signs of damage on the hinges.

Get rid of the Door: To repair the hinges, you'll need to eliminate the door from the frame. Start by removing the screws that hold the hinges to the door frame. Then, carefully raise the door off the hinges and put it on a flat surface area.

Examine the Hinges: Once the door is eliminated, examine the hinges for any indications of damage. Try to find loose screws, bent or damaged hinge leaves, or any other visible damage.

Repair or Replace the Hinges: If the hinges are repairable, tighten up any loose screws and hammer any bent hinge leaves back into location. If the hinges are beyond repair, eliminate them from the door and frame and replace them with brand-new ones.

Fill Any Holes: If you've gotten rid of the old hinges, you'll likely be left with holes in the door and frame. Fill these holes with wood filler, permit it to dry, and then sand it down up until it's smooth.

Reattach the Door: Once the wood filler is dry and sanded, reattach the door to the frame utilizing the brand-new hinges. Make certain the door is level and aligned appropriately before tightening the screws.

Frequently asked questions:
Can I repair a bifold door hinge myself, or do I need to work with an expert?
While it is possible to repair a bifold door hinge yourself, it might be simpler to employ an expert if you're not comfy dealing with tools or if the damage is comprehensive.
How frequently do bifold door roller repair door hinges requirement to be replaced?
Bifold door hinges can last for many years with appropriate maintenance. However, they may need to be replaced every 5-10 years, depending upon usage and wear and tear.
Can I utilize any type of hinge for my bifold door?
No, it's crucial to utilize hinges particularly developed for bifold doors. These hinges are made to accommodate the folding movement of the door and will make sure smooth operation.
How do I understand if my DIY Bifold door Repair door hinges are beyond repair?
If the hinges are significantly bent, rusted, or have broken leaves, they might be beyond repair and need to be replaced.
Can I paint or stain my bifold door after fixing the hinges?
Yes, as soon as the wood filler is dry and sanded, you can paint or stain your bifold door refurbishers door to match the rest of your design.
